The Hyper-V Virtualization Stack
Virtual Devices are managed by the Virtual Motherboard (VMB). Virtual Motherboards are contained within the Virtual Machine Worker Processes, of which there is one for each virtual machine. Virtual Devices fall into two categories, ''Core VDevs'' and ''Plug-in VDevs''. Core VDevs can either be ''Emulated Devices'' or ''Synthetic Devices''.
